Just possibly the best ARPG ever
I never played the original Titan Quest, but got this version on a whim. It is the blatant Diablo 2 clone it looks like, but just as enjoyable as the original and different enough to be its own game and not just an imitation. First, the setting: I was a bit sceptical about the game taking place not in a made-up Fantasy world but in historical Antiquity, with mythology-based monsters. But the game creators did their research - they did take some freedoms, obviously, but the world does feel quite authentic, and this makes for a refreshing change for the player. Second, the class system: I was a bit irritated when I did not get to chose a class at beginning, still was confused when I got to select a "mastery" at my first level-up and finally got it when I reached level 8 and had the option to add a second mastery. In this game, you select a class by chosing two masteries, each of which has an extensive skill set. With nine masteries, that is a lot of options, and as far as I can tell every possible combination is viable for playing. Of course, some combinations will be easier than others, but they all work, and all of them are fun. And "fun" is very much the key word here - Titan Quest is not a game which will challenge you intellectually, but if Action RPGs have any kind of appeal for you, chances are you will love this. I certainly did (and still do!). The amount of classes gives a high replayability, and there is lot of loot to discover, too - not just the usual epic and legendary items, but Titan Quest has something called "monster infrequents", special items that drop from a specific kind of monster and which just beg to be farmed. The only issue I have is that there is no character customization beyond male and female. Especially with the amount of different characters your are likely to end up creating, it would have been nice to have more differentiation. But that is admittedly a minor niggle, and overall this may very well be the best ARPG ever.
